Housing Market Better Than It Looks

By Alison RogersHome prices rose 0.1% on a seasonally adjusted basis in March, according to new numbers from the S&P/Case-Shiller index. But four cities showed worse results in March than they had in February, with Atlanta notably down 0.4% over the previous month and Detroit down 2.1%.
